Ingredients

For this healthy Greek salad with chicken, you’ll need:

  • 2 cups romaine lettuce, chopped
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cucumber, diced
  • 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/2 cup Kalamata olives, pitted
  • 1/2 cup feta cheese, crumbled
  • 1 pound cooked chicken breast, sliced
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Each ingredient adds a distinct flavor, contributing to the overall harmony of the salad. Keeping the assembly straightforward helps in maintaining the dish’s freshness.

Directions

  1. In a large bowl, combine romaine lettuce,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, Kalamata olives, and feta cheese.
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, red wine vinegar, oregano, salt, and pepper.
  3. Drizzle dressing over the salad and toss gently to combine.
  4. Top the salad with sliced chicken breast.
  5. Serve immediately or store in the refrigerator for meal prep.

Techniques to Enhance Your Salad

Technique

When preparing a healthy Greek salad with chicken, technique matters. Start with the freshest ingredients possible. Sourcing seasonal vegetables elevates flavor and ensures crispness. Wash and dry the lettuce thoroughly to avoid sogginess. When chopping vegetables, aim for uniform size to ensure even distribution in the salad.

Incorporating the right mixing technique creates a harmonious balance of flavors. Toss the salad gently—this prevents bruising the lettuce while ensuring that every bite is full of tantalizing taste.

Tips/tricks

For those looking to elevate your healthy Greek salad with chicken, consider a few handy tips. First, marinating the chicken breast in olive oil and oregano beforehand adds depth to the flavor. Letting it rest boosts tenderness, making it even more enjoyable in the salad.

Another tip involves adding a surprise ingredient. Try tossing in some avocado, which adds creaminess, or a sprinkle of sunflower seeds for an added crunch. Make it your own and play with different textures and flavors to celebrate your creativity in the kitchen.

Troubleshooting/variations

At times, you might encounter challenges when preparing a healthy Greek salad with chicken. If your salad seems too acidic, a dash of honey or a sprinkle of sugar can counterbalance the tang in the dressing. Conversely, if it’s lacking in flavor, a pinch of salt and pepper or extra herbs can enhance your experience.

Variations will also bring new life to your salad. Consider different protein options, such as grilled shrimp or tofu, to switch things up based on your taste preferences. Experimenting with different vegetables, like bell peppers or radishes, provides a new twist while keeping the core essence intact.

Pairings/storage

Pair your healthy Greek salad with chicken alongside whole-grain pita bread or a side of hummus for a complete Mediterranean meal experience. If you’re keen on a bit of crunch, complement with some roasted nuts or seeds that add texture and flavor.

For storage, this salad holds well in the refrigerator. Keep dressing separate if you plan to store it for meal prep to maintain freshness. The salad typically lasts for up to three days, savoring the excellent flavors it brings even after a day in the fridge.
